The iPhone 6 and iPhone 6 Plus have set a new record for Apple pre-orders with more than four million advance orders for the new iPhones logged in the first 24 hours of availability. That smashes the previous pre-order record for iPhones, set two years ago by the iPhone 5s with 2 million pre-orders. The pent-up demand for the larger-screened iPhones seems to finally be spilling out, so much so that shipping times for many iPhone 6 models have slipped to a week or more, and all iPhone 6 Plus models have been pushed back to October for any new orders.
